Fastway pegs fitted OK and look/feel dandy with the shorter 8mm (I think) studs and in the standard (not lowered position) just as I had on my previous GS. Running them in the 'flattest' position (the angling bolt at the back screwed right in).

Only a short ride home and the next will be to Dover next weekend for a wee spin around the Alps.

I noticed I do tend to leave my balls of my feet resting on them still though rather than flat as I ended up on the previous bike. Maybe it's just a case of getting used to them again. Bloody thing wants to make me hoon which doesn't help :).
